LabVIEW vs Maple: The Verdict

⚡ Summary:

LabVIEW: LabVIEW is a visual programming platform used by engineers and scientists to develop complex measurement, test, and control systems. It uses a graphical interface to visualize code, similar to building a flowchart.

Maple: Maple is a proprietary computer algebra system used for mathematical computation. It offers capabilities for algebraic manipulation, calculus operations, visualization tools, and more. Maple is commonly used in academia and research for solving complex mathematical problems.

Key Features Comparison

LabVIEW
LabVIEW Features
  • Graphical programming language (G language)
  • Built-in debugging tools
  • Large library of built-in functions and VIs
  • Integration with hardware devices and instruments
  • Data acquisition, analysis and visualization
  • Can create executables and stand-alone applications
  • Supports object oriented programming
  • Can call .NET assemblies and use .NET technologies
  • Can build web applications and web publishing tools
  • Can create GUIs and front panels
Maple
Maple Features
  • Symbolic computation
  • Numeric computation
  • Visualization and animation
  • Documentation tools
  • Connectivity with other applications

Pros & Cons Analysis

LabVIEW
LabVIEW

Pros

  • Intuitive graphical programming
  • Rapid application development
  • Easy to visualize data flow and debugging
  • Large ecosystem of add-ons and toolkits
  • Integrates well with hardware and instruments
  • Can create full-featured applications
  • Active user community and support

Cons

  • Steep learning curve
  • Proprietary development environment
  • Expensive licenses and toolkits
  • Not ideal for non-engineering/scientific apps
  • Limited adoption outside of NI hardware ecosystem
  • Code can be difficult to maintain and document
Maple
Maple

Pros

  • Powerful symbolic and numeric capabilities
  • Intuitive graphical interface
  • Extensive function library
  • Can handle complex computations
  • Wide range of visualization tools

Cons

  • Expensive licensing model
  • Steep learning curve
  • Not ideal for statistical analysis
  • Limited compatibility with Excel and MATLAB
